• As Oracle Financial Consultant, you'll effectively deliver/implement Oracle Finance modules in order to provide an integrated information system solution to the business users.
PRIMARY D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
Provide expertise and knowledge in the Fusion ERP Cloud Finance Modules - GL, AR, AP, Fusion Tax, Fusion Assets, BPM Approvals, Fusion Reporting tools, like OTBI, Financial Reporting Studio, Smart View, BI Publisher SCM HCM, and Integration with third-party applications.
Actively participate in analysis, requirements gathering, design, development, testing, and implementation phases.
Write and maintain business requirements and functional documentations.
Identify functional gaps and provide corrective actions.
Respond to users queries and concerns promptly and resolve technical and operational problems in a timely fashion
Provide ERP functional consulting & training to our finance users
Supports multiple projects/tasks within the Oracle ERP portfolio and their related business applications.
Develop reports, tables, fields, data interfaces, application extensions, dashboards, and data import/export within the Oracle Fusion ERP.
Must be a constant learner and be able to keep up with emerging trends and technology changes
Should extensively work on Oracle Fusion Finance processes. Good Understanding of Business Flows and processes.
Excellent Analytical and Debugging skills in problem-Solving in a Fusion Cloud environment. Demonstrate good knowledge of SQL, PL/SQL, and will be able to create reports in OTBI using SQLs.
Ability to work on multiple assignments simultaneously.
Ability to interact and communicate with end users independently.
Experience in end-to-end Development / Implementation / Support activities covering expertise areas such as the design of customizations and executing Test cycle rounds including Closing.
Qualifications ·
At least 5-8 years of Oracle Finance E2E implementations and Support exposure with minimum of 3-4 years in Oracle Fusion cloud.
Should have worked on Data migrations and familiar with Integration of other systems from a techno-functional point of view
Extensive knowledge of functional setups of Business Units, Organizations, Departments, Divisions, etc.
Must have good issue debugging skills in Fusion Environment and must know Oracle cloud support processes. Knowledge of Oracle cloud quarterly upgrades and will be able to work with Oracle Cloud Support effectively.
Work experience on any other ERP module like HR, Payroll, Procurement etc. would be an added advantage.
Must have a Bachelors / Master’s degree in Computer Science
Candidate with at least 3-5 years of experience in Logistics / Telecom or Financial Industry preferred.
